WebMay 12, 2024 · 1. Max Server Memory is set at the instance level: right-click on your SQL Server name in SSMS, click Properties, Memory, and it’s “Maximum server memory.”. This is how much memory you’re willing to let the engine use. … WebNov 11, 2009 · You can tel SQL Express to not use more than a certain amount using some SQL : use master Go exec sp_configure 'show advanced options', 1; Go RECONFIGURE; GO exec sp_configure 'max server memory (MB)', 700; GO RECONFIGURE; GO – MartW Nov 12, 2009 at 0:12 Add a comment Your Answer Post Your Answer
